Master of Technology (M.Tech) in Avionics is a two-year program that dives into the electronic systems used in aviation and aerospace. It blends electronics, instrumentation, and aerospace engineering, teaching how to build, test, and manage electronic systems for planes, satellites, drones, and spacecraft. The candidates will learn about flight control systems, navigation, radar tech, embedded systems, signal processing, and avionics software.
The candidates should have a B.Tech or BE degree in Electronics and Communication Engineering, Electrical Engineering, Instrumentation, Aerospace Engineering, or a related field. Most universities require at least 50-60% grades in your undergraduate degree. Although many colleges administer their own entrance tests or interviews, GATE results are generally accepted and often necessary for admission to elite colleges such as IITs, NITs, and IIITs.
The MTech Avionics fees range from 1,00,000 to 4,50,000 on a university basis. Private colleges with better laboratories and industry relations can charge more fees, while government institutions such as IIST, IIT Bombay and NITs are generally cheaper.

What is M.Tech in Avionics?
M.Tech Avionics is a specialized master degree course in the field of engineering that deals with learning about aircraft instrumentation, control systems, navigation, communication, and embedded systems as applied to aerospace vehicles.
- It combines the expertise of electronics, computer science, and aerospace engineering and applies this integration to create and control advanced avionics technology of planes, spacecraft, and unmanned aerial vehicles (UAVs).
- The program focuses both on theoretical and practical courses and includes simulation, system-design, and implementation of flight control and navigation systems.

M.Tech in Avionics Vs MTech Aerospace Engineering
MTech Avionics is more focused on the electronic and control systems of aircraft and spacecraft, while MTech Aerospace Engineering provides a broader understanding of aerodynamics, propulsion, and structural aspects.

What kind of avionics projects are M.Tech students working on?
M.Tech students usually get involved in some pretty cool projects involving flight control systems, drones, satellite communications, navigation systems, and sensors for aerospace. Some focus on creating cockpit interfaces, autopilot setups, or communication systems that keep planes safe and reliable. Others might design smart avionics that enhance safety, cut down on weight, or boost efficiency during flights.

How do internships fit into the M.Tech in Avionics program?
Internships are really important in this program. Students typically intern at places like HAL, ISRO, DRDO, private aerospace companies, avionics labs, or defense tech startups. These internships give them hands-on experience with real avionics issues, like working on sensor integration, testing communication systems, or simulating flight controls. Plus, they get to make connections in the industry.
What is the salary of avionics engineer?
The average salary of an avionics engineer in India ranges from approximately INR 3 to 6 LPA for entry-level positions. With mid to senior-level experience, salaries can rise significantly, ranging from INR 7 to 10 LPA depending on the employer, location, and expertise.

What tools or software do avionics engineering students use?
Students use a variety of tools and software like MATLAB/Simulink, LabVIEW, Xilinx, and ModelSim for simulation and embedded system work. For designing PCBs and circuits, they go with Altium Designer and OrCAD. For flight simulations and control, common tools include FlightGear, STK, ANSYS HFSS, and GNSS-SDR. These tools are essential for building, testing, and fixing real avionics systems.
